Output 2d3f8e9ee64a9e3805d084e346c9265fbf572f51926b980847de04e3d885041a:1

value
29186066216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de8c7360c5b39b204d77d8178f44c0cadebedc94 OP_EQUAL
address
3MykBpFc6BFUoAzNEmjrFvoxutvBGAQSAY
transaction
2d3f8e9ee64a9e3805d084e346c9265fbf572f51926b980847de04e3d885041a
spent
true